Joshua Levine is excited to be a part of UBS Financial Services and heads up The Levine Social Investment Group. As a Financial Advisor, Joshua works with individual investors, small businesses, and nonprofits to address their short- and long-term financial needs. In addition to providing financial planning and a comprehensive package of financial services, Joshua has a core strength in Socially Responsible Investing. Joshua prides himself in establishing a consultative relationship with his clients to preserve their wealth and develop a properly diversified portfolio. He then strives to empower his clients to make investment decisions that are in line with their personal ethics. Joshua holds the professional designation of Accredited Investment FiduciaryTM (AIF®). Designees of the AIF® work with institutions to understand and articulate the legal and regulatory environment surrounding fiduciaries, develop and implement an effective investment management process applying the principles of Modern Portfolio Theory, document all due diligence, and above all, treat their clients with the utmost prudence and care. Joshua Levine received his Bachelor’s of Science in Civil and Environmental Engineering from the University of California, Los Angeles. Upon graduation, he moved to New York City and joined the leveraged finance division of Scotia Capital, Inc. Joshua then moved on from his Associate role to receive his Master’s degree in Environmental Science and Management from the Donald Bren School of Environmental Science & Management at the University of California, Santa Barbara. In addition to his professional activities, Joshua is actively involved in environmental and social organizations in the San Francisco Bay community. He currently sits on the Board of Directors for: Urban Releaf, a youth-based organization whose goals are beautification and tree planting in low- to moderate income communities; and Audubon Canyon Ranch, an environmental conservation and education-based organization in Marin County.
